The Guptill family is proud to announce their 38th season of laughs, music, and drama in their converted barn; known to many as one of New England's most charming and quaint summer theatres, The Hackmatack Playhouse. The 2010 summer Hackmatack Playhouse schedule includes Cinderella, Leading Ladies, Carousel and Hello, Dolly.

The enchanting fairy tale, Rodgers and Hammerstein's Cinderella is reborn on the Hackmatack stage with charm, humor, warmth, and wonderful music. It runs June 24 through July 10.

Next, July 14 through July 24, Ken Ludwig's cross-dressing crowd pleaser, Leading Ladies adds fun and a few twists to the Hackmatack stage.

Many famous songs including If I Loved You, You'll Never Walk Alone, and June is Bustin' Out All Over are featured in Carousel running July 28 through August 14.

Later in the summer, August 18 through the 28th, it's the delightful musical comedy, Hello, Dolly. Carol Channing originated the role of Dolly and she never missed a single performance. You don't want to miss Hello, Dolly at Hackmatack Playhouse in Berwick.

Special pre and post season nights are still being organized.
